Healthy Apple Muffins

These healthy apple muffins are naturally sweet, perfectly moist, and sugar-free! Made with wholesome ingredients, they’re a delicious and nourishing option for breakfast or as a yummy snack.

Ingredients


  • 1 3/4 cups flour of choice
  • 1 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/3 cup melted coconut oil or olive oil
  • 1/2 cup maple syrup
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/2 cup plain Greek yogurt (or dairy free yogurt)
  • 1/2 cup applesauce
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 3 apples, grated

Instructions


  1. Preheat the oven Preheat the oven to 425°. Grease muffin tin if necessary.
  2. Mix dry ingredients Combine flour, baking powder, cinnamon, baking soda, and salt in a large mixing bowl.
  3. Mix wet ingredients Combine oil, maple syrup, eggs, yogurt, applesauce, and vanilla in a medium mixing bowl.
  4. Pour wet ingredients into dry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ients, add the shredded apple, and mix until combined. Make sure not to over mix.
  5. Bake Pour the muffin batter into the muffin tin and bake for 13 to 16 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ean. Remove from the oven and let cool for 5 minutes.
